Chapter 71 - The Alliance Unraveled

The day had started like any other, with the clamor of activity echoing through the rebel camp. Austan, however, had been greeted by an urgent message that threw everything into disarray. A key alliance, one of their most promising and critical, was on the brink of collapse. Internal conflicts and external pressures had begun to unravel the partnership, threatening to destabilize the fragile support network the rebels had painstakingly built.

As Austan walked towards the central meeting tent, he felt the weight of the situation pressing heavily on his shoulders. The alliance with the Free Cities' faction had been pivotal. Their resources, intelligence, and military support had provided a significant boost to the rebels' efforts. Losing their support now would be catastrophic.

Elena was already waiting inside the tent, her expression serious. She glanced up as Austan entered, her eyes reflecting the same concern he felt. "We've received word that the Free Cities are on the verge of pulling out. There are rumors of internal strife and pressure from the emperor's agents."

Austan took a deep breath, trying to steady his nerves. "What do we know about the specifics of the conflict?"

Elena handed him a stack of documents and reports. "It appears there are disputes over resources and influence among their leaders. Some factions within the Free Cities feel that our alliance has not been beneficial enough to justify the risks they're taking. Others are being pressured by the emperor's agents, who are exploiting these internal divisions."

Austan scanned the documents quickly. The situation was dire. The Free Cities were critical for their plans to disrupt the emperor's supply lines and gather intelligence. Without their support, their operations would be severely compromised.

"We need to act fast," Austan said, his mind already racing through potential solutions. "If we don't address this now, we risk losing not only their support but also our position in the wider conflict."

Elena nodded. "I agree. We need to find a way to address their grievances and reassure them of our commitment. We also need to counteract the emperor's influence and prevent any further destabilization."

Austan decided to travel to the Free Cities themselves to try and salvage the alliance. He knew that direct intervention and negotiation were their best chances to address the issues at hand. They prepared for the journey, gathering their most trusted advisors and setting out with a sense of urgency.

Upon arrival, they were greeted by a tense atmosphere. The Free Cities' council had called an emergency meeting to address the crisis. Austan and Elena were led into a grand hall where the leaders of the Free Cities were gathered. The hall was filled with an air of discord, with voices raised in heated debate.

Austan took a deep breath and stepped forward. "Thank you for meeting with us on such short notice. We understand that there are serious concerns about our alliance, and we are here to address them directly."

The room fell silent as the leaders turned their attention to Austan and Elena. One of the senior leaders, a stern man named Loric, spoke up. "The Free Cities have faced significant challenges due to our alliance with you. We have risked our resources and faced pressure from the emperor's agents. Many of us are questioning whether the benefits of this alliance outweigh the costs."

Austan nodded, acknowledging their concerns. "I understand your frustrations. The situation has been more challenging than anticipated, and we recognize the sacrifices you have made. However, I want to assure you that our commitment to this alliance is unwavering. We are here to address your grievances and find a way to move forward together."

Another leader, a woman named Elysia, added, "Our people are growing weary. We need concrete assurances and tangible results. Words alone will not be enough to restore trust."

Elena stepped forward, her voice calm but firm. "We are prepared to offer additional support and resources to address the issues you've raised. We have made significant strides in our operations, and we can demonstrate the progress we've made. Additionally, we are willing to renegotiate the terms of our alliance to better align with your needs and concerns."

The leaders exchanged glances, their expressions reflecting a mix of skepticism and hope. Loric spoke again, "We need to see concrete evidence that our contributions are making a difference. We also need assurances that we won't be left vulnerable to the emperor's retaliation."

Austan and Elena took careful notes, ensuring they addressed each concern raised. They discussed specific adjustments to their strategic plans, including increased support for the Free Cities and a more transparent sharing of intelligence and resources.

As the negotiations continued, tensions remained high. The leaders of the Free Cities were cautious but willing to listen. Austan and Elena presented a revised plan, outlining how they would adjust their operations and support to better meet the needs of their allies.

Hours passed, and the debate grew increasingly intense. The stakes were high, and Austan could feel the pressure of the situation weighing heavily on him. The success of their mission depended on their ability to navigate these complex negotiations and restore trust.

Finally, after much discussion and compromise, an agreement was reached. The terms of the alliance were revised to address the concerns raised by the Free Cities. In exchange for their continued support, the rebels agreed to provide additional resources, improve communication, and offer greater protection against imperial retaliation.

The leaders of the Free Cities reluctantly agreed to uphold their end of the alliance, but the scars of the conflict were evident. The road to rebuilding trust would be long and challenging.

The Free Cities remained an essential ally, but the recent crisis had highlighted the need for continued vigilance and careful management of their relationships.

Back at the rebel camp, the news of the renewed alliance was met with a mix of relief and wariness. The rebels understood that while the immediate crisis had been averted, the underlying tensions remained. They would need to work diligently to maintain the support of their allies and navigate the ongoing challenges of the conflict.
